See access arrangements coordinator jobs in LancashireThe average salary for an it technician in Lancashire is £25,175 per year, typically ranging from £20,900 per year to £30,400 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.
Lancashire tends to sit around 5% below the UK average for it technicians.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.

IT Technicians in Lancashire typically increase pay by moving up NJC SCP 10–18,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ications, or relocating to a higher-paying region such as London.
Nationally the average is £26,500 per year. In Lancashire it's £25,175 per year — a discount of £1,325 per year versus the UK average.
